Fix common Task and board problems

Find the cause of a missing task, blocked update, unavailable board, or empty calendar.

Start with the symptom below. Access rules and filters explain most missing work. A failed save may also mean someone changed the task at the same time.

A task is missing

  1. Clear task search and all filters.
  2. Check the current area. My Tasks shows assigned and personal work. A client board shows that board's work.
  3. Check Archived Tasks.
  4. Confirm you still belong to the client account.
  5. Ask a team member to check the board, section, task, and parent-task access rules.

Task search matches titles only. A word found only in the description, comment, or file will not return the task.

A client cannot see a task

The client needs active account membership and access to the board, section, task, every parent task, and the current view.

Check for Team only, Custom, Hidden from portal, private-task, read-only, and client-hidden-view settings. Read-only work should still be visible, but the client cannot change it.

A task board will not open

The board may be archived, removed, or limited to a list of people that does not include you. Review task-board and section settings before recreating it.

  • Restore an archived board from Manage all task boards or Archived Task Boards.
  • Ask a board manager to review Portal access or Custom access.
  • A removed board cannot be restored through the product.

For privacy, an unauthorized board can look the same as a board that does not exist.

A task update failed

Refresh the task and try again. Common causes include:

  • the task, section, or board changed while your page was open;
  • you lost access;
  • a client-facing task or section became read-only;
  • the task moved to another board or section;
  • an old direct link points to archived or removed work; or
  • another person changed tags, due dates, or dependencies at the same time.

Do not repeat a destructive action until you confirm whether the first try saved.

A task is marked Blocked

The task has at least one open direct blocker. Open Dependencies and complete or remove every blocker. A client may see only Blocked when the blocking task is private.

A task is missing from the calendar

  1. Make sure the board's Date view is enabled.
  2. Add a due date to the task.
  3. Clear filters.
  4. Confirm the task is on the current board and inside the visible date range.
  5. Confirm you can access its section and parent tasks.

Mobile Month shows task counts on each day. Select a day to open the seven-day Agenda. Repeating tasks appear on the calendar, but simple calendar dragging cannot change their date.

A board, section, or task cannot be created

  • An account can have five active standard boards. Archive one before adding or restoring another.
  • Every account must keep one active board.
  • Every board must keep one active section.
  • A board stops offering task creation at 500 active tasks.
  • A client cannot create in a read-only or hidden section.
  • Portal users cannot manage boards.

A reminder did not arrive

Confirm that the task has an assignee, a future reminder time, an open status, an active account, and an active board. Then check the assignee's email, spam folder, unsubscribe settings, email delivery status, and current access.

Reminder delivery is scheduled and may happen shortly after the selected time.

A template insertion failed

Open the template in Task Center → Templates. A template with no tasks or a saved template error cannot be inserted. Save a corrected version, then try again. Missing assignees or unavailable older attachments may be skipped with a warning. Review task template limits and version behavior.

What your client sees

Clients receive safe errors and filtered results. Sydnee does not expose hidden board, section, task, parent, or blocker names just to explain an access failure.
